What are Crypto Futures?
Before diving into risk management, let's quickly cover what futures are. Imagine you agree to buy 1 Bitcoin at a specific price on a specific date in the future. That's a futures contract. You don’t own the Bitcoin *now*, but you have an obligation to buy it later.
Crypto futures trading allows you to speculate on the price of a cryptocurrency *without* actually owning it. You can profit if your prediction is correct, but you can also lose money if you're wrong. A key feature of futures is leverage.
Understanding Leverage
Leverage is like borrowing money from the exchange to increase your trading position. For example, with 10x leverage, you can control a $10,000 position with only $1,000 of your own money.
- This magnifies both your profits *and* your losses*. If the price moves in your favor, your gains are multiplied. But if it moves against you, your losses are also multiplied – and can happen very quickly. This is why risk management is so important. Why is Risk Management Important?
Without risk management, you're essentially gambling. Even the best trading strategy can fail, and unexpected market events can cause significant losses. Risk management aims to:
- Protect your capital.
- Minimize potential losses.
- Increase your chances of long-term success.
- Avoid emotional trading.
Key Risk Management Techniques
Here are some practical techniques you can use:
- **Position Sizing:** This determines how much of your capital you risk on a single trade. A common rule is to risk no more than 1-2% of your total trading capital on any single trade.
* Example: If you have a $1,000 trading account, risk only $10-$20 per trade.
- **Stop-Loss Orders:** A stop-loss order automatically closes your trade when the price reaches a predetermined level. This limits your potential loss.
* Example: You buy a Bitcoin future at $30,000. You set a stop-loss at $29,500. If the price drops to $29,500, your trade is automatically closed, limiting your loss to $500 (minus fees).
- **Take-Profit Orders:** A take-profit order automatically closes your trade when the price reaches a predetermined profit target. This secures your gains.
- **Risk/Reward Ratio:** This compares the potential profit of a trade to the potential loss. A good risk/reward ratio is generally considered to be at least 1:2 or higher (meaning you're aiming to make at least twice as much as you're risking).
- **Diversification:** Don’t put all your eggs in one basket! Trade different cryptocurrencies to spread your risk.
- **Using Appropriate Leverage:** Starting with lower leverage is crucial. As you gain experience, you can gradually increase it, but always be cautious.
- **Regularly Reviewing Your Trades:** Analyze your past trades to identify what worked and what didn't. Learn from your mistakes.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
- **Trading with Emotion:** Fear and greed can lead to poor decisions.
- **Increasing Leverage Without Experience:** This is a recipe for disaster.
- **Ignoring Stop-Loss Orders:** A stop-loss is your safety net.
- **Chasing Losses:** Trying to "make back" lost money quickly often leads to even bigger losses.
- **Not Diversifying:** Putting all your capital into a single trade is extremely risky.
- **Failing to Learn:** Continuous learning is essential in the dynamic world of crypto.
